Orie-Zappala War: Shots At The Eastern Front

Chief Justice Ronald Castille has fired a remarkably direct (among the enrobed) shot across Justice Joan Orie Melvin's judicial bow, suggesting events have constrained her recusal prerogative with respect to Pennsylvania Supreme Court cases considering prosecutions involving Allegheny County District Attorney (and big-game Orie-hunter) Stephen A. Zappala Jr.

Can anyone provide links to the Chief Justice's public oration concerning the ethics of district attorneys' (1) public declarations of innocence (despite all appearances) involving family members before any investigation has concluded, or (2) promotion of undeclared interests with respect to real estate development projects involving public funds, or (2) investigations of family members revealed to have failed to disclose financial and/or lobbying interests associated with the gambling industry?
